### Per-Tenant Rate Quotas

Gatestone enforces quotas with a token bucket per tenant, refilled on a fixed tick. Buckets live in the shared cache, so changes propagate within one tick without redeploys. Burst capacity is deliberately generous; sustained rate is the real ceiling. Overages return a retry hint rather than dropping silently. The governing constants are:

tuning table, faduf-baduf:
PRIORITIES = {
    "ulavan": 191,
    "silys": 750,
    "goriel": 238,
    "kelmir": 66,
    "wendor": 432,
}

### v3.2.0 — Renamed setting

Keyspindle no longer reads `KS_ROTATE_TOKEN`; it was renamed for consistency with the plugin API. Plugins targeting 3.2+ must use the new name or rotation hooks will not fire. The old name is ignored silently — no deprecation warning is emitted. Update your `.env` before upgrading. Keep `KS_PLUGIN_DIR` and `KS_LOG_LEVEL` as-is. Immediately after those entries, add the renamed token line with your existing value.

secret setting of kawif-kajef: COURIER_KEY3=d2b

Ticket: Expired credentials for Broadpane diff viewer. Support team: users opening diffs on files larger than 20 MB are seeing blank panes because the Broadpane viewer's credential for the Hollis chunk-render service expired Tuesday. Smaller files render locally and are unaffected, which explains the inconsistent reports. A fresh credential has been issued and validated in staging; please use it when reproducing cases. The replacement key is below.

app token of yajeg-kawef = kto11_7En3XSX8xQw

# Build Provenance: ChipGate Reader Firmware

The ChipGate timing-chip reader used at Halloway Bay Marathon events runs firmware built from the `gatekeep` repo via our signed pipeline. Every deployed image is traceable: the pipeline embeds a provenance record at flash time. On-call engineers should never flash unsigned images, even during race-day incidents. To verify what a reader is running, compare its boot banner against the trace token listed below.

trace token, kawip-fafog: htk14_26e64c4d35154e